Summer Plans With the return of high temperatures and humidity, it seems summer is here for sure. The Celebration of Pentecost was the last Sunday for the choir to sing before beginning a summer break. The singers worked hard, but we’ve managed to incorporate hearty laughs and fellowship between

learning parts and polishing our anthems. It’s hoped some individuals will be at worship to offer special music over the summer. On July 23 and August 20 (please note: this is a change of date), we’ll introduce ‘Summer Choir:’ an opportunity for regular choir members and anyone else who would like to come for a 10:20 a.m., Sunday morning rehearsal to pre-pare an anthem for that Sunday. Nothing too tricky yet worthy to praise our Lord; and singers can return to the pews after the anthem is presented. Preludes for the summer will include some based on American-bred, simple melodies and one that requires ‘wedges’ between pedals to sustain tones throughout the piece. A Brahms piece My Heart Abounds with Pleasure, is based on a German melody with an espe-cially appropriate text that well expresses what many of us hold in our hearts:

My heart abounds with pleasure in this fair summer time. When God, with fullest measure, renews the world benign.

All earth and all the Heavens doth God with life imbue; All creatures high and lowly, grow beautiful and true.

Soli Deo Gloria Janice Seigle – Director of Music

A Sacred Conversation on Race with the Adult Sunday School Class

Hands up if you want to dialog about race and how it affects our church, commu-nity, and nation! If so, please join us this fall as we engage in this honest conver-sation using the United Church of Christ material White Privilege. This curricu-lum is an effort to allow us to see with new eyes how privilege works. It offers the promise and the possibility that those who commit to engaging in this dia-logue can develop higher degrees of awareness of privilege and its consequences. We all know that there are racial divides in our country. What can we learn by looking at the spiritual autobiographies of others told through the lens of race? This is the beginning of a journey. If we truly believe all are welcome here, we need to honestly focus on who we are and what this means. Jesus said, "Let those who have eyes to see, see." The curriculum is divided into four parts, and each one is designed to help us "see" the world of white privilege and its impact. While there are many tracks ahead on which one might seek to do social justice, this is designed to help us identify some basic truths and lift our awareness as a first step. "Because to be normal is to unquestionably be human, whiteness as the norm brings all other human lives into question." John Dorhauer, General Minister and President of the United Church of Christ. Honest discussions and searching can only lead us to be a more open and God-filled church. We will prepare resources for as many as express an interest, and you are encouraged to invite anyone from the community of all races and ethnici-ties. It is not necessary to attend every session, but it might be helpful to read over the materials, so you have an understanding of each week's focus. So mark your calendars and join in, beginning September 17 at 9:30 AM tentatively in the conference room.

BABY BOTTLE CAMPAIGN 2017

Due to the resounding success of last year's effort, the Lay Life and Mission Committee has chosen to promote the Life-Way Pregnancy Center in August and September. The center will provide plastic baby bottles for us to take home and fill with loose change or folding money. They will be collected at the end of August (or sooner if they are full).

Life-Way provides life affirming alternatives, pregnancy and parenting support and social/community referrals. An "Earn While You Learn" program allows parents to earn points to buy needed nursery supplies. Supporting this agency is our way of reaching out to young families in our own community. Expect to see the baby bottles in August.

GREATER LATROBE CARING PROGRAM

Each summer, the Lay Life and Mission Committee requests donations of sweat shirts, sweat pants, shorts and t-shirts to restock supplies in local schools. The schools require that these items be “logo” free or “plain.” Students, at times, have an emergency need for clothing due to accidents of many types during the school day. Monetary gifts are also welcome.
